On 9th June 2005, after the International Court of Justice's ruling against Israel's apartheid wall, a coalition of Palestinian Civil Society Organisations issued a ‘Call for Boycott, Divestment and Sanctions against apartheid Israel until it complies with International Law'.

Boycott Israeli goods intends to campaign for Boycott, Divestment and Sanctions in line with this call from Palestinian civil society.


The campaign works to:



  • Boycott Israeli goods and services

  • Boycott Israeli cultural and sporting institutions who do not condemn Israel's ilegal occupation
  • Boycott Israeli academic institutions and academics who do not condemn Israel's ilegal occupation

  • Promote a campaign against tourism in apartheid Israel

  • Promote divestment from companies who invest in apartheid Israel or profit from Israel's occupation and apartheid policies

  • To camapign against companies who invest in apartheid Israel or profit from Israel's occupation and apartheid policies

  • To persuade businesses to stop trading with apartheid Israel

  • To campaign for an end to European Union government trade agreements with Israel

  • To campaign for UK and EU sanctions against apartheid Israel until it complies with international humanitarian law

  • To promote initiatives to decrease the isolation of the occupied Palestinian people and promote ethical, fairly traded Palestinian goods.
